There are two main problems: water retention and fat storage. While the water stuff is not a problem (reducing sodium, after cycle it will leave itself) the increasing insulin resistance is the bigger problem. Serveral studies have shown that the decreasing of insulin sensitivity starts fast with the beginning of the cycle and lasts for approx. 26 (!) weeks.

This fact decreases the attractivness of MK-677 a bit. Remember: it's still a powerful drug but you have to pay 10x more attention WHAT you are eating (amount and quality). Bad input leads to bad output.
You can still use MK-677 short term (<3 months) or run it moderate to long term (6-12months). In the second case you will have the advantage that your body will regenerate itself beloning to the insulin sensitivity. In the first case (and in the second case for the first six months) you have to watch out like your neighbours watch dog.

Nevertheless, the increase of GH, IGF-1 and the enourmous regeneration time under MK-677 makes it still very attractive.

Does this told fact MK-677 more attractive during a cutting phase? Maybe. The reduced insulin sensitivity leads in any cases to a higher probability to storage the nutrition in the fat instead in the muscle.

Pay attentions folks. If you treat MK-677 like it deserves it will give you its true love. If not, you will gain like me 4.4lbs fat and nearly 4lbs water beside 9.9lbs lean mass (with a strong SARM stack).

From personal experience currently running MK it is responsible for my recomp effects. After 5 months use my BF% has dropped considerably despite no changes to my diet. Having said that changes did not come overnight and it was around the 3 month mark at 25mg ED I started noticing benefits in terms of fat loss while continuing to gain lean mass. Pumps in the gym are insane too much like I got training as a teen.

As an older guy (31) I can bascially eat like I did in my early 20's. It feels good to turn back the clock in atleast this one apsect. Ofcourse benefits/sides are going to be subjective. If you're not one to experience sides associated with MK there's a lot of good to come from it. If it makes you eat like a madman all the time no doubt you'll gain fat. Having been VERY sensitive to MK from the getgo, Insomnia, anxiety etc (had to start at 5mg doses) all I experience now is the benefits.

I do believe it's the initial sides which can for many be overcome in time as studies have also shown that keep people off the MK bandwagon. Biggest problem is most companies selling MK don't recommend a strategic "loading phase". We always preach going easy on anabolics (low doses) to assess and mitigate sides but never in regards to MK.
